Verifying/Updating Firmware

It is important to run the latest level of firmware. To ensure that you are running
the latest levels of library firmware, drive firmware, and SNMP MIB (Management
Information Base) file, complete this procedure.
1. Verify the SNMP MIB file currently installed on your SNMP server. Verify the
2. Download the latest library firmware, drive firmware, and SNMP MIB
3. Update library and drive firmware on your library, if necessary.

levels of library and drive firmware currently installed on your library by
completing the following steps:
a. Expand Monitor Library in the left navigation pane of the Web User
Interface.
b. Click Library Identity and make note of the Firmware revision.
c. Click Drive Identity and make note of the Firmware revision.
d. Log out of the Web User Interface.
